Management Commentary
During the post-earnings public call, Arvinas leadership centered discussions on operational milestones achieved over the quarter, rather than the expected negative EPS result. Management noted that quarterly operating expenses were consistent with internal budget forecasts, with the vast majority of total spend allocated to research and development activities, including clinical trial enrollment, lab research, and platform development for its protein degradation technology. Leadership confirmed that the negative EPS figure was in line with internal projections, as the company continues to prioritize pipeline advancement over short-term financial metrics. The team also addressed questions regarding cash runway, noting that current capital reserves, including funds from existing collaboration agreements, are sufficient to cover planned operational spending for the next several years under current forecast timelines. Leadership also highlighted that interim clinical data readouts shared alongside the earnings release met pre-specified safety and efficacy benchmarks for one of its lead programs, a point of focus for most investor questions during the call.

Forward Guidance
As a pre-commercial biotech firm, Arvinas (ARVN) did not provide formal revenue guidance for upcoming periods, consistent with standard disclosures for companies in its development stage. The company did share that it expects operating expenses to remain elevated in coming operational periods, noting that R&D spending would likely stay high as it advances multiple lead candidates through mid- and late-stage clinical trials. Arvinas also noted that it may potentially pursue additional strategic partnerships or financing arrangements to support late-stage development and eventual commercialization efforts, though no definitive agreements had been signed as of the earnings release date. The company emphasized that any potential future cash inflows, including milestone payments from existing partners or eventual product sales, are contingent on successful clinical trial outcomes, regulatory approvals, and successful execution of development plans, all of which carry inherent uncertainty.

Market Reaction
Following the release of the the previous quarter earnings report, trading activity in ARVN shares reflected mixed market sentiment. Trading volume was slightly above average in the sessions immediately following the release, as investors digested both the expected financial results and new pipeline updates shared by the company. Analysts covering the biotech sector published notes after the call stating that the reported EPS was largely aligned with consensus estimates, so the financial results did not trigger significant unanticipated moves in share price. Some analysts highlighted positive sentiment around the company’s recently shared interim clinical data, while others noted that Arvinas faces typical risks associated with clinical-stage drug developers, including potential trial delays, regulatory setbacks, and shifts in spending needs if development timelines change. Broader sector trends for biotech stocks may also influence near-term trading activity for ARVN, alongside upcoming clinical data readouts outlined by the company in its release.
